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83384487813 47129 088731781
2016303124 572060 934
2016303124 572060 934
7154416953 253 578
All about undefined
Interested in learning more?
2016303124 572060 934
7154416953 253 578
See more
45205877 89
2082 1089256 75777832 65524336911
See more
29588085104 692979585 07075
90138 497877 418683
See more